Containers, iterators, and container adaptersThe so-called container, which is the most frequently used data structures, is implemented with class templates to accommodate specific types of objects. Depending on the characteristics of the data in
JAVA Collection class-a rare Summary
The following documents are summarized in your learning and hope to help you. If you want to reprint it, thank you.
1. StringBuffer thread security, StringBuilder thread security efficiency is slightly
Definition of a doubly linked list
A doubly linked list is also called a doubly linked list, which is a list of two pointers in each data node, pointing directly to successive and direct precursors respectively. So, starting from any node in a
This section describes freelists and sharedpoollrulist. freelist idle list is divided by bucket. There are a total of 255 buckets. bucket0 --- bucket254 each bucket has a chunklist; freelists have unused chunkRESERVEDFREELISTS: the number of buckets
SGI-- Silicon Graphics [Computer System] Inc. Silicon graph [Computer System] Company.
STL-- Standard Template Library: Standard Template Library.
Container Concept
The STL container is to implement the most commonly used data structures.
A
List as long as there are two implementation classes (ArrayList and LinkedList), Arrylist is based on the implementation of the array, LinkedList is based on the implementation of the list, the following is the little brother to LinkedList
It mainly completes primary storage. secondary storage. and virtual storage. this includes the ing between disk files and virtual memory and the ing between virtual memory and memory. to ensure consistency between virtual storage and process
This is a creation in
Article, where the information may have evolved or changed.
Introducing Go
Directory
1 Get Started
2 type
3 variables
4 Control Structure
5 Arrays, Slices, and Maps
6 Functions
7 Structs and Interfaces
8 Package
9
This article introduces the content of the link list in PHP implementation, has a certain reference value, now share to everyone, the need for friends can refer to
Start learning about data structures
Today write code changed a font, used to
Introduction and use of PHP double-chain table (spldoublyshortlist), php linked list. PHP double-chain table is an important linear storage structure. for each node in a double-chain table, not only store your own information, but also the
Data structure is still very important, even if it is not the kind of very good, but at least to know the basics of things, this series even to review the data structure previously learned and fill their knowledge in this piece of the vacancy. Come
First, the realization of the Java_collections tableUnlike C, Java has implemented and encapsulated ready-made table data structures, sequential tables, and linked lists.1, ArrayList is based on the implementation of the array, so it has the
DescriptionThis article is "Data structure" flip class online answer to the record, from the Cloud class "answer/Discuss" function to export data compiled."Important Tips"The following content, according to the time from the back to the next order
Basically, it feels like the original list of links form a linked list through node allocation, but it is dangerous to not automatically eliminate node, and once the list has been assigned other values before clear () the memory leaks.Therefore, the
Sequential containersVector: Quick insert and delete from behind, direct access to any elementDeque: Quick Insert and delete from front or back, direct access to any elementList: Double linked list, quick insert and delete from anywhereAssociative
Title Description Enter a binary search tree and convert the two-fork search tree into a sorted doubly linked list. Requires that no new nodes can be created, only the point pointer of the node in the tree can be adjusted.1 /*2 struct TreeNode {3
A contiguous space in memory. List, memory address can be discontinuous, each node of a linked list contains the original memory and the next node information (one-way, two-way list, there will be two).Arrays are better than linked lists:1. Memory
10th Chapterworking with structures and pointers
Single linked list
typedef struct NODE {struct NODE *link;int value;} Node;Insert into an ordered single-linked list:#include #include #include "sll_node.h"#define FALSE 0#define TRUE
DataFirst, the collectionSecond, linear structure (emphasis)There is a one-to-one relationship between elements and elementsStorage mode:Sequential storage (sequential table)Chained storage (linked list: single-linked list, one-way loop linked list,
The content source of this page is from Internet, which doesn't represent Alibaba Cloud's opinion;
products and services mentioned on that page don't have any relationship with Alibaba Cloud. If the
content of the page makes you feel confusing, please write us an email, we will handle the problem
within 5 days after receiving your email.
If you find any instances of plagiarism from the community, please send an email to:
info-contact@alibabacloud.com
and provide relevant evidence. A staff member will contact you within 5 working days.